Trending Famous Solar PV Module Component Connector Dominates Guarantees Peak Performance

Connector Type Maximum Voltage (V) Current Rating (A) Temperature Range (°C) IP Rating Certifications
MC4 1000 30 -40 to +85 IP67 CE, TUV
MC4-Evo2 1500 32 -40 to +85 IP67 UL, IEC
H4 Connector 1000 40 -40 to +90 IP68 TUV, RoHS
Amphenol H4 1500 40 -40 to +85 IP68 UL, IEC, RoHS
